About this course

At least two years recent and relevant experience working with children in either paid or voluntary employment. e. completed in the 12 months prior to the start of the programme).

A full level 3 in Early Education & Childcare or equivalent. A level 3 full and relevant qualification (as listed by the DfE) in Early Education & Childcare is needed to work within a nursery environment and also to be counted in ratio. shtml Please note that this Foundation Degree is not full & relevant.
